Job Summary

The Banquet Captain is responsible for supervising and assisting with the set up service and clean up of all assigned banquet functions.

  • Inspect the set-up of meeting and banquet functions checking them against the Banquet Event Order.
  • Supervise and assist with the set-up of assigned catered functions ensuring that the hotel's standards are met and advance preparation for service is adequate to allow efficient service to the guest once the function begins.
  • Act as the liaison between Sales/Catering Manager and the in-house meeting or banquet contact.
  • Respond to guests' problems complaints and accidents. Communicate problems/issues to the Banquet Manager Banquet Supervisor or Food and Beverage Manager.
  • Assist Banquet Manager/Supervisor/F&B Manager with the creation of the Banquet Work Schedule and completion of Banquet Wage Progress Reports.
  • Assist in service of functions as required.
  • Assist in banquet set-up as required.
  • Requisition liquor for all banquet bars and maintain proper control over banquet beverage service.
  • Supervise and assist with the break down after the completion of functions to ensure that all equipment and supplies are stored properly.
  • Inspect the sanitation of all function space and storage areas to maintain the highest standard of cleanliness and organization throughout the department.
  • Follow all state liquor laws.
  • Be familiar with banquet menus and prices.
  • Know hotel services and facilities.
  • Enforce all hotel policies and safety rules.
  • Be familiar with fire exit and fire extinguisher locations and know how to operate.
  • Supervise Banquet staff as directed by Banquet Manager/Banquet Supervisor/F&B Manager.
  • Be familiar with and enforce all Standard Operating Procedures for the Banquet department.
  • Hold pre-function meetings and check staffing and menus prior to events.
  • Make sure all required equipment is available for event.
  • Give job tasks to servers and assign stations.
  • Supervise service of station or room.
  • Prepare banquet checks and obtain signatures from guest contact.
  • Monitor ongoing functions throughout assigned shift.
  • Assist servers throughout function.
  • Supervise clean-up.
  • Verify servers' paperwork when event is complete.
